Let M=(aij), i,j∈{1,2,3}, be the 3×3 matrix such that aij=1 if j+1 is divisible by i,otherwise aij=0. Then which of the following statements is(are) true?
1
M is invertible
2
There exists a nonzero column matrix such that M =
3
The set { } 0, where 0=
4
The matrix ( M-2I) is invertible, where I is the 3×3 identity matrix
